In a landmark move that underscores its commitment to bolstering American manufacturing, Apple Inc. has announced a substantial investment of $500 billion in the United States. This ambitious plan includes the establishment of a cutting-edge semiconductor plant by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company (TSMC) in phoenix, Arizona, a development poised to considerably enhance domestic chip production capabilities. As global supply chains face unprecedented challenges, Apple’s strategic investment aims to not only secure its own supply chain but also contribute to the revitalization of U.S. manufacturing. Apple’s Landmark Investment in U.S. Manufacturing and Its Economic Implications
Apple’s bold commitment to injecting $500 billion into U.S. manufacturing signifies a pivotal moment in the tech industry and the broader economic landscape. This investment is set to generate tens of thousands of jobs across various sectors, from skilled labor in semiconductor manufacturing to roles in logistics and supply chain management.
